28 000 students out of pocket as hiccups stall NSFAS payments

Johannesburg - While more than R9billion has been paid out to more than 500000 students by the National Student Financial Aid Scheme , about 28000 have yet to receive their allowances. According to Higher Education, Science and Technology Minister Blade Nzimande, this was the amount paid as of last month.

“Funds have been disbursed to 536848 students in the form of allowances, leaving 28163 students still to be paid," Nzimande said. The figures show an improvement compared with disbursements last year when the financial scheme experienced challenges, including funding decisions, addressing the 2017 academic year backlog, the non-payment and delays in the payment of allowances and weakness in data integration between NSFAS and institutions.
